Match the following terms with the correct definition -o,-s,-t,-mus,-tis,-nt
lapo4ka [179]

Answer:

6. they- nt

7. we- mus

8. you(singular)- s

9. you(plural)- tis

10. he,she,or it- t

11. I- o

Explanation:

here is an example using the verb amo,amare,amavi,amatus

am<u>o</u>- I love                           ama<u>mus</u>- We love

ama<u>s</u>- You(sing) love           ama<u>tis</u>- You(plural) love

ama<u>t</u>- He,she,it loves          ama<u>nt</u>- They love
